源代码加密技术可以应用于人工智能开发,保护算法和模型的安全。在软件开发过程中,源代码加密可以帮助开发者实现代码的可维护性,降低维护成本。通过加密源代码,开发者可以更好地保护自己的声誉和形象,提高品牌价值。源代码加密技术可以应用于大数据处理,保护数据的隐私和安全。代码加密是一种保护软件安全的重要手段。通过加密源代码,开发者可以有效地防止代码被恶意篡改或者盗用。这种加密技术可以确保软件的完整性,并保护用户的数据安全。源代码加密可以防止别人对软件进行逆向工程分析。当源代码加密后,别人无法直接读取和理解源代码的内容,从而保护了软件的知识产权和商业利益。加密后的源代码可以减少软件被恶意攻击和滥用的可能性。江苏图纸源代码加密产品
在加密过程中应尽量减少对源代码的修改,避免引入新的漏洞和错误。应尽量使用成熟的加密算法和加密框架,以减少风险。加密后的源代码应存储在安全可靠的环境中,防止未经授权的访问和篡改。应定期备份源代码,以防止意外丢失或损坏。在编译和运行时,应确保使用的是正确和完整的加密密钥和参数,避免出现解开秘密不完全或者解开秘密错误的情况。在设计加密方案时,应考虑到源代码的版本控制问题。如果一个源代码文件被加密,那么每次更新这个文件时,都需要对新的文件进行正确的加密。江苏图纸源代码加密产品源代码加密加密方法可以防止别人窃取软件的关键功能。
为了确保用户体验,软件开发团队需要针对加密技术对软件性能的影响进行优化。这包括选择高效的加密算法、合理的加密策略以及利用多线程、异步操作等技术手段来提高性能。除了性能优化,企业还需要关注加密技术的更新和维护。随着加密技术的不断发展,新的加密算法和方案不断涌现。企业需要密切关注加密技术的发展动态,及时更新加密策略,以确保源代码加密技术始终具有较高的安全性和可靠性。同时,企业还需定期对加密系统进行维护,以确保加密系统的稳定运行。企业还可以通过合作伙伴关系来加强源代码保护。与其他企业或组织建立合作伙伴关系,共享技术和资源,可以帮助企业降低单一来源的风险。通过合作伙伴关系,企业可以互相学习和交流加密技术,共同应对潜在的安全威胁,提高整个行业的加密技术水平。
有一种常见的源代码加密方法是使用代码混淆器。代码混淆器可以将源代码转换为难以理解的代码。这种方法可以防止源代码被逆向工程,但缺点是混淆后的程序可能会出现运行错误。除了上述方法,还有其他一些源代码加密方法,如使用数字签名、使用加密算法等。这些方法可以提高程序的安全性,但缺点是需要专业知识和技能才能正确使用。源代码加密虽然可以提高程序的安全性,但也有一些需要注意的问题。首先,源代码加密不能保证程序的安全性,因为攻击者可以使用其他方法攻击程序。其次,源代码加密可能会导致程序运行速度变慢,影响用户体验。源代码加密可能会增加程序的开发成本,因为需要花费更多的时间和资源来编写和测试加密代码。源代码加密可以有效地防止软件被篡改和植入病毒,保证软件的完整性和可靠性。
源代码加密可以帮助开发者保护软件的特色功能和独特设计,防止竞争对手通过简单的复制和模仿来获取市场份额。加密源代码可以帮助开发者建立更好的商业模式和盈利模式。通过保护软件的商业机密和知识产权,开发者可以更好地设计和实施商业模式,创造更多的价值。源代码加密可以降低软件的漏洞被发现和利用的风险。当软件的源代码加密后,别人和攻击者需要更多的时间和资源才能发现和利用漏洞,增加软件的安全性。加密源代码可以保护软件的革新和研发成果。对于一些创新性的软件,加密源代码可以保护开发者的独特设计和创新成果,防止被其他人非法使用和复制。加密后的源代码更难以分析和修改,增加了攻击者的成本。江苏图纸源代码加密产品
源代码加密技术可以用于防止代码的篡改和代码被恶意代码的情况。江苏图纸源代码加密产品
应该定期对加密代码进行测试和验证,以确保其仍然可以正常工作。这有助于发现和解决潜在的问题,并提高代码的可维护性。在编写加密代码时,应该考虑其与其他系统的交互方式。如果加密代码与其他系统紧密相关,应该确保其与其他系统的接口易于理解和维护。为了保证加密后的源代码的可维护性,应该避免在代码中使用全局变量。全局变量可能会导致代码难以维护和理解。应该使用有用的命名约定和注释来描述加密代码中的变量和函数。这有助于其他开发人员更容易地理解和维护代码。江苏图纸源代码加密产品